#CAE02B Hex Color Code
#CAE02B
The Hexadecimal Color #CAE02B is a contrast shade of Green Yellow. #CAE02B RGB value is rgb(202, 224, 43). RGB Color Model of #CAE02B consists of 79% red, 87% green and 16% blue. HSL color Mode of #CAE02B has 67°(degrees) Hue, 74% Saturation and 52% Lightness. #CAE02B color has an wavelength of 577.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CAE02B is #CCFF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CAE02B is #CD3. The Closest Color to #CAE02B is #ADFF2F. Official Name of #CAE02B Hex Code is Pear.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CAE02B is 10 Cyan 0 Magenta 81 Yellow 12 Black and #CAE02B CMY is 10, 0, 81.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CAE02B
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.
The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.
The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.
The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
